There were some new exhibits I thoroughly enjoyed:…read more Cafes and Cabarets: the spectacular Art of Toulouse-Lautrec known for his beguiling portraits of Paris nightlife and immortalizing the cabaret culture of Belle Époque Paris. Chanell Stone: Undulation of a Rupture during a journey through the Mississippi Delta. Black and white photographs invite reflection on the Mississippi River as both a natural force and a historical passageway. The museum created an atmosphere of this exhibit with a deeply emotional connection and experience. Graciela Iturbide, arguably Latin America's best-known living photographer from Mexico. This exhibition surveys her most iconic photographs, primarily captured in Mexico, but also worldwide. Also, Dutch Paintings on loan from Boston Museum of Fine Arts. I came during the Great Exchange and it was free if you have membership with a participating museum. It's also free for San Diego residents on the third Tuesday of the month.     Pretty cool little art museum showcasing local graduating artists, most of which are earning a…read moreMasters in Fine Arts. Located in the middle of Balboa Park, West of El Prado, you'll find this small little museum filled with one or two pieces of work, from each of the 7 artists. Since there's only approximately 15-20 pieces, you'll likely get through here in 30 mins or so. When I visited several days ago, the museum was FREE, as long as you provided them with your zip code. That may mean that it's only free for locals, so you might want to call ahead. It's great to see an art space showcasing local collegiate talent. If you're already heading to, or visiting Balboa Park, it's worth a free visit. Enjoy!
